Jared Ehrhart is a scholar working on Neurology, Physiology and Neurology. According to data from OpenAlex, Jared Ehrhart has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 2.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Neurology, 14 papers in Physiology and 13 papers in Neurology. Recurrent topics in Jared Ehrhart's work include Neuroinflammation and Neurodegeneration Mechanisms (20 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(13 papers) and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(10 papers). Jared Ehrhart is often cited by papers focused on Neuroinflammation and Neurodegeneration Mechanisms (20 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(13 papers) and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(10 papers). Jared Ehrhart collaborates with scholars based in United States, Japan and China. Jared Ehrhart's co-authors include Nan Sun, Jin Zeng, Paul R. Sanberg, Jun Tan, R. Douglas Shytle, Huayan Hou, Kirk Townsend, Jun Tan, Takashi Mori and Terrence Town and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Journal of Neuroscience.
